Category : | Sub Category : Posted on 2023-10-30 21:24:53
Introduction: In the world of computer vision and image analysis, researchers and practitioners are constantly developing new techniques to unlock the infinite possibilities hidden within visual data. One such powerful tool is the ontology Fisher vector algorithm for images. This algorithm, combining the strengths of ontology and Fisher vectors, enables us to extract deep semantic understanding from images, paving the way for advancements in various domains, including object recognition, image retrieval, and scene understanding. Understanding the Basics: Before diving into the intricacies of the ontology Fisher vector algorithm, let's briefly outline the fundamental concepts it builds upon: ontology and Fisher vectors. 1. Ontology: An ontology is a structured representation of knowledge that categorizes objects, concepts, and relationships within a domain. In the context of computer vision, an ontology can define a hierarchical structure for describing the different elements present in images, such as objects, scenes, and attributes. 2. Fisher Vectors: Fisher vectors are a powerful image representation technique that captures the statistical properties and spatial layout of local image features. They encode both the mean and covariance matrix of the features, providing a compact and effective representation for image analysis tasks. The Ontology Fisher Vector Algorithm: The ontology Fisher vector algorithm bridges the gap between high-level semantics and low-level visual features, enabling us to extract meaningful information from images. Here's a step-by-step overview of the algorithm: 1. Ontology Construction: The first step is to construct an ontology tailored to the specific domain of interest. This involves defining a set of relevant concepts, establishing hierarchical relationships, and annotating the ontology with appropriate labels and attributes. 2. Semantic Feature Extraction: Next, local features are extracted from the images using techniques like scale-invariant feature transform (SIFT) or convolutional neural networks (CNNs). These features are then mapped to the corresponding concepts in the constructed ontology. 3. Fisher Vector Encoding: The extracted semantic features are encoded using Fisher vectors, capturing both the mean and covariance information. This results in a compact representation that retains the discriminative power of the original features. 4. Semantic Aggregation: To incorporate high-level semantic information, the encoded Fisher vectors are aggregated according to the hierarchical structure defined in the ontology. This aggregation process captures the contextual relationships between different objects, scenes, or attributes within an image. 5. Classification and Retrieval: Once the Fisher vectors are aggregated, they can be used for various image analysis tasks, such as object recognition, image retrieval, or scene understanding. By leveraging the rich semantic information encoded in the ontology Fisher vectors, these tasks can achieve higher accuracy and robustness. Applications and Advantages: The ontology Fisher vector algorithm has found applications in numerous domains, including autonomous driving, surveillance systems, medical imaging, and social media analysis. Its advantages over traditional methods include: 1. Semantic Understanding: By incorporating high-level semantics, the algorithm enables a deeper understanding of complex visual scenes. 2. Contextual Relationships: The hierarchical structure of the ontology captures the contextual relationships between different concepts, enhancing the accuracy of image analysis tasks. 3. Compact Representation: The Fisher vectors encode both mean and covariance information, resulting in a compact representation that is efficient for storage and computation. 4. Domain Adaptation: The ontology can be tailored to specific domains, allowing the algorithm to be easily adapted to different applications and datasets. Conclusion: The ontology Fisher vector algorithm for images represents a significant advancement in the field of computer vision and image analysis. By combining the power of ontology and Fisher vectors, this algorithm enables researchers and practitioners to extract rich semantic information from images, leading to enhanced performance in object recognition, image retrieval, and scene understanding tasks. With its diverse applications and advantages, it is poised to reshape our understanding of visual data and unlock new possibilities. To get more information check: http://www.coreontology.com